Have you ever wanted to save, organize, and share your favorite recipes from different websites? Use "My Recipe Box" to create folders, add recipes from anywhere online just with one click, and share your folders with any of your friends who have this extension. Simply click on the extension once you have installed it to add new folders, then add recipes to them by clicking the buttons next to each of your folder titles when you are looking at the recipe webpage. Click "See Recipes" to view all your recipes, add notes ("I love this bread recipe with whole wheat flour!"), and share folders with your friends. |
